To properly shim your toilet, you’ll need a few essential tools. Here are the top 5 items you’ll need:

  • Toilet shims: These small wedges are specifically designed to stabilize and level your toilet. They are available in various thicknesses to accommodate different toilet models and flooring types.

  • Adjustable wrench: This tool will come in handy for loosening and tightening the bolts that secure your toilet to the floor.

  • Caulk gun: A caulk gun is necessary for applying a bead of caulk around the base of the toilet after shimming, ensuring a watertight seal.

  • Level: A level is crucial for determining if your toilet is properly aligned and balanced.

  • Rubber gloves: It’s always a good idea to wear gloves when working with toilets to protect yourself from bacteria and other contaminants.

Common Mistakes to Avoid When Shimming a Toilet

Make sure you avoid these common mistakes when shimming a toilet. Shimming a toilet may seem like a simple task, but there are some common errors that can lead to troubleshooting issues down the line. Here are five mistakes to watch out for:

  • Using the wrong type of shims: It’s important to use plastic or rubber shims specifically designed for toilets. Using wooden shims can cause damage to the toilet or lead to leaks.

  • Over-shimming: Adding too many shims can put unnecessary pressure on the toilet and lead to rocking or instability.

  • Uneven shimming: Make sure the shims are evenly placed around the base of the toilet to ensure stability.

  • Not checking for leaks: After shimming, it’s crucial to check for any leaks around the base of the toilet. Ignoring this step can result in water damage and costly repairs.

  • Not tightening the toilet bolts: Ensure that the toilet bolts are properly tightened after shimming to prevent any movement or wobbling.

Understanding Toilet Flush Pressure

To understand toilet flush pressure, we need to break it down into its components and examine how they work together.

The mechanics of a toilet flush involve a combination of water pressure, siphoning action, and gravity. When the flush lever is activated, it lifts the flapper valve, allowing water to flow from the tank into the bowl. The force of the water entering the bowl creates pressure, which helps to initiate the siphoning action.

As the water level rises in the bowl, it eventually reaches a point where the siphon is triggered, causing a rapid and powerful flush. The impact of water pressure on flush performance is crucial.

Insufficient pressure can lead to weak or incomplete flushes, while excessive pressure can cause splashing or even damage to the toilet.

Exploring Ways to Increase Toilet Flush Pressure

One effective way to increase toilet flush pressure is by adjusting the water fill valve. The water fill valve is a crucial component of toilet flush mechanisms, as it controls the flow of water into the toilet tank.

By adjusting this valve, you can increase the water pressure during the flush, resulting in a more powerful and efficient flush.

Advertisement

To adjust the water fill valve, locate it inside the toilet tank. Typically, it can be found on the left side of the tank. Use a screwdriver to turn the adjustment screw clockwise to increase the water pressure or counterclockwise to decrease it.

tall toilets for elderly

It’s important to make small adjustments and test the flush after each adjustment to achieve the desired pressure. Remember to shut off the water supply before making any adjustments to avoid any accidents.

Implementing DIY Solutions for Stronger Flushes

Now, let’s explore some practical ways we can implement DIY solutions to achieve stronger flushes more frequently.

Here are three plumbing modifications you can make to increase the flush pressure of your toilet:

  1. Adjust the fill valve: By adjusting the fill valve, you can increase the amount of water entering the tank, which in turn increases the flush pressure. This can be done by turning the adjustment screw on the fill valve clockwise to increase the water level.
  2. Clean or replace the flapper: A worn-out or dirty flapper can obstruct the flow of water and reduce the flush pressure. Cleaning or replacing the flapper can improve the flush performance.
  3. Install a dual-flush system: Dual-flush systems offer a water-saving alternative while providing a strong flush. These systems have two buttons, allowing you to choose between a partial flush for liquid waste and a full flush for solid waste.
